Ways battery storage solutions Enhance residential solar Services
- Enhancing Energy Independence and Grid Reliability
One of the most significant advantages of battery storage is achieving greater energy independence. Traditional grid-tied solar systems rely on utility companies to provide electricity when solar panels are not generating power. Homeowners are still affected by power outages, fluctuating energy rates, and grid instability. With battery storage, excess solar energy is stored and used when needed, reducing dependence on external power sources.
Battery storage provides a critical backup power source for homeowners in areas prone to power outages due to extreme weather conditions or grid failures. When the grid goes down, an appropriately sized battery system can continue supplying electricity to essential appliances, such as refrigerators, lighting, and heating or cooling systems. Unlike traditional backup generators, battery storage solutions do not require fuel, operate quietly, and provide seamless transitions during outages. Residential solar services help homeowners choose the right battery capacity based on their energy needs, ensuring uninterrupted power supply even during emergencies.
Battery storage also stabilizes energy consumption by reducing demand on the grid during peak hours. Utility companies often charge higher rates during times of increased electricity use. Homeowners can avoid these higher costs by drawing power from stored energy instead of the grid during peak hours and contributing to a more balanced energy distribution system. This benefits individual households and supports overall grid reliability and efficiency.
- Maximizing Solar Energy Usage and Reducing Wasted Power
Excess solar energy that is not used immediately is often sent back to the grid without a battery storage system. While net metering programs allow homeowners to earn credits for this excess power, the rates at which utilities compensate for this electricity vary. Some utility companies reduce net metering credits over time, making sending excess energy back to the grid less financially beneficial. Battery storage provides an alternative by allowing homeowners to store and use their energy rather than relying on utility compensation.
By integrating battery storage with residential solar services, homeowners can ensure that all the energy their solar panels generate is used efficiently. Stored power can be used at night, during cloudy days, or when energy demand in the home increases. This ability to manage energy consumption helps homeowners make the most of their solar investment while reducing dependence on utility companies.
Additionally, having battery storage allows for better energy planning. Homeowners can strategically charge batteries when solar production is high and discharge energy when rates are highest, optimizing energy costs. Residential solar service providers assist in setting up battery management systems that automate this process, making it easy for homeowners to control their energy use without manual intervention.
- Reducing Electricity Bills and Increasing Financial Savings
One of the main reasons homeowners invest in solar energy is to lower electricity costs. Battery storage further enhances these savings by allowing homeowners to control when and how they use their energy. In areas where time-of-use (TOU) electricity pricing is in effect, utility companies charge higher rates during peak hours and lower rates during off-peak times. With battery storage, homeowners can store solar energy during the day and use it during peak pricing periods, avoiding expensive grid electricity.
Battery storage also helps reduce reliance on utility companies, protecting homeowners from rising electricity prices. As energy rates continue to increase, having the ability to store and use solar energy when needed provides long-term financial security. Over time, the savings generated from using stored energy instead of grid power can offset the initial cost of installing battery storage.
Residential solar service providers assist homeowners in selecting the proper battery storage system based on their energy needs, budget, and available incentives. Many regions offer tax credits, rebates, and financing programs to help reduce the upfront cost of battery storage, making it a more accessible option for homeowners. By taking advantage of these financial incentives, homeowners can further increase their return on investment and enjoy long-term savings on their electricity bills.
- Supporting Sustainability and Reducing Carbon Footprint
Battery storage solutions contribute to environmental sustainability by maximizing clean, renewable energy. Without storage, homes rely on grid electricity during non-solar hours, often from fossil fuel-based power plants. By storing and using solar energy even when the sun is not shining, homeowners can minimize their reliance on fossil fuels and reduce carbon emissions.
Residential solar services help homeowners design systems that align with their sustainability goals. By combining solar panels with battery storage, households can significantly decrease their carbon footprint while maintaining a stable and renewable energy supply. In areas where utilities impose restrictions on net metering or limit the amount of solar power that can be sent back to the grid, battery storage ensures that no clean energy is wasted.
As battery technology improves, energy storage systems become more efficient and environmentally friendly. Many modern batteries use recyclable materials and have longer lifespans, reducing their environmental impact. By investing in solar energy with battery storage, homeowners contribute to a more sustainable energy future while enjoying the practical benefits of energy independence and cost savings.
